POS与数字航空相机集成系统数据后处理方法研究
Data post-processing method of POS integrated with aerial digital camera
【摘要】 机载POS与数字航空相机集成系统用于直接地理定位数据获取,本文研究集成系统数据后处理方法,设计IMU偏心角、偏心分量解算的数学模型,利用地对地检校场数据及实际航摄影像数据验证了该数据处理方法的正确性和可行性,并进行直接定向精度验证。
【Abstract】 Airborne POS and aerial digital camera integration system is used for direct geographical positioning data acquisition,this paper studied the integration system data post-processing method and a function model of solving boresight misalignment and IMU offset vector was designed.Based on the calibration field data and actual flight data,this paper not only validated the validity and the feasibility of the data processing method,but also verified the accuracy of direct georeferencing.
